The recent death of Hezbollah leader Hassan Nasrallah in an Israeli airstrike has left a significant impact on the militant group and its supporters across the Middle East. Known as a larger than life figure, Nasrallah was revered by Shia Muslims and hailed as a hero for his resistance against Israel.

However, Nasrallah’s legacy is seen as mixed, with some praising his unwavering commitment to the cause and others criticizing his militant tactics that have resulted in heavy losses for Hezbollah. The recent attack on communications devices used by Hezbollah members, which led to numerous casualties, has further highlighted the ongoing conflict between Israel and the militant group.

Despite suffering major losses, Hezbollah has continued to launch rockets at Israel, indicating their determination to retaliate and defend their allies such as Hamas. The situation has escalated with Iran getting involved in the conflict, firing missiles into Israel and referencing Nasrallah’s death as a motivation for their actions.

The future of Hezbollah remains uncertain as they face internal and external challenges, with questions arising about their leadership and strategic direction. As the conflict intensifies, it is clear that Nasrallah’s death has not only shaken the militant group but also the wider region, raising concerns about the escalating tensions and the potential for further violence.
